Phase 4: Implement SSH packet size limit (maxpack - 1024)
- Add maxpack field to SftpHandler structure - Modify SftpHandler::new() to accept maxpack parameter - Limit SSH_FXP_READ data size to maxpack - 1024 bytes (OpenSSH style) - Get maxpack from Channel.remote_maxpacket Changes: - sftp_handler.rs: SftpHandler struct + new() + handle_read() - channel.rs: Pass remote_maxpacket to SftpHandler::new() Reference: OpenSSH sftp-server.c: process_read() - Limit: maxpacket - 1024 bytes - Prevent packet size violation Test status: 5MB upload still incomplete (2.0MB) - Issue may require additional debugging - Upload direction may also need maxpack limit
